
MUMBAI: After winning hearts with her powerful presence in The Diplomat, actress Sadia Khateeb is back on set, ready to bring another compelling story to life. The talented actress has officially begun shooting for her next film titled Silaa, and the journey commenced with an auspicious mahurat clap alongside acclaimed director Omung Kumar.
The launch ceremony was held with all the traditional fervor, signaling the beginning of what promises to be an emotional and impactful narrative. Known for his sensitive storytelling and visually striking direction, Omung Kumar has previously helmed acclaimed films like Mary Kom and Sarbjit, raising expectations for what’s to come from Silaa.
While plot details are still under wraps, early reports suggest that the film will explore a socially relevant theme, centered around a strong female protagonist — a genre that has consistently brought out Sadia’s best performances. Her ability to portray layered characters with grace and depth has earned her praise in every project, from her debut in Shikara to commercial ventures like Raksha Bandhan and the intense political drama The Diplomat.
The pairing of Sadia Khateeb with Harshvardhan Rane has already generated buzz in the industry, with insiders hinting that Silaa could be one of the most emotionally driven scripts in recent times. The project is also expected to feature a talented supporting cast, with more announcements to follow soon.
